Rocky Mountain College powwow
Hosted by the American Indian Student Council and Native American Outreach.
Grand entry at 1:00pm
Non-contest with (5) specials
Masters of Ceremonies: Jerome White Hip & Leonard Bends
Arena Director: Jacob Brien
Host Drum: Wolf Bear

A Pow Wow is a Native American tradition that brings together many different tribes and communities. Pow Wows are cultural celebrations that include dancing, singing, socializing, crafts, arts, and food.
